Our Tips for Keeping your Body Hydrated During Travel

As relaxing and enjoyable as traveling can be, getting there can sometimes be a hassle. Between dealing with crowds, delays, and other stressful factors, the last thing you need to be worried about is your health.
Dehydration is one of the leading causes of health complications travelers encounter on vacation. The pressure, temperature, and oxygen levels in a plane cabin fluctuate, and the humidity level is lower than it is at sea level, according to Cleveland Clinic's Matthew Goldman, MD. Besides the dehydration you will inevitably face while getting to your destination, factors such as weather, activity and exercise, and alcohol consumption can very quickly lead to dehydration even once you’re back on the ground. Dehydration can then cause numerous other health and safety concerns, which is the last thing you need while on vacation.
Here are some of our tricks for staying hydrated on your next trip.
Miracle Mojito
If you’re staying in a villa or hotel with a kitchen, making this drink, especially after a day full of traveling or enjoying cocktails, will totally revitalize you. Although consuming alcohol dehydrates you, we understand that you're in vacation mode. So enjoy alone, add a splash of rum, or even tequila. The other healthy and hydrating ingredients will lessen the effects of your hangover!

Ingredients:
½ an English cucumber
½ a lemon or lime
Frozen ginger cubes (any kind of ginger will work)
Pineapple juice
Water or sparkling water
Mint leaves
Ice
Alcohol of choice
Instructions:
Using a blender or food processor, combine all dry ingredients with a half cup of pineapple juice and a half cup of water. Strain over ice (hot tip! use coffee filter if you can’t find a strainer). Add mint and enjoy!
